Tanakh

/tɑˈnɑx/
Meanings (ES + gloss)
Tanaj
The body of Jewish scripture comprising the Torah, the Neviim (prophets) and the Ketuvim (writings); corresponding to the Christian Old Testament (or roughly so, depending on the denomination).
Meronyms: Torah, Neviim, Ketuvim
